✈️How to get to Pigeon Lake Music Festival
Planning your trip to Pigeon Lake Music Festival? Here's how to get there by plane, train or car, and plan your route to the festival site.
- Nearest airport: Edmonton International Airport (YEG), about 39 km from the venue.
- Allow about 55 min by car from the airport to the site.
- By train, head for Edmonton or the nearest major station, then finish by bus, shuttle or taxi to the site.
- By car, plan for on-site parking and expect heavy traffic around the venue on festival days.

Pigeon Lake Music Festival 2026: Alberta's pop and rock gathering
Pigeon Lake Music Festival is a musical event held at Hilah Ayers Wilderness RV Park, near Pigeon Lake, Alberta. This outdoor festival combines camping and concerts in a natural setting, attracting festival-goers for a weekend of Canadian pop, rock, and hip-hop.
The 2026 edition brings together 14 artists, headlined by Classified, Bran Van 3000, and Coleman Hell. The lineup celebrates the diversity of the Canadian music scene, from alternative pop to psychedelic rock.
The festival explores a wide musical spectrum: alternative rock, indie pop, hard rock, and industrial rock sit alongside more electronic sounds with trip hop and EDM. Festival-goers will also discover artists like Sass Jordan and Headstones for energetic rock performances.
